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uffs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uffs Market size was estimated at USD 341.78 million in 2025 and expected to reach USD 361.93 million in 2026, at a CAGR of 5.52% to reach USD 498.12 million by 2032.

Identifying the Pivotal Technological and Regulatory Developments Reshaping the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uff Market Dynamics Worldwide

Over the past few years, the nylon pressure infusion cuff market has experienced transformative shifts driven by breakthroughs in sensor integration, wireless connectivity, and smart monitoring capabilities. Clinical users now expect real-time pressure feedback and automated safety cut-offs, reducing the risk of over-pressurization and adverse patient events. These technological advancements mark a departure from traditional analog devices, elevating the standard of care and placing pressure cuffs at the forefront of digital health ecosystems.

In parallel, regulatory frameworks worldwide have tightened controls on single-use and reusable medical accessories to mitigate cross-contamination risks. Regulatory bodies now require rigorous validation of sterilization processes, compelling manufacturers to innovate around durable materials and robust disinfection protocols. This has accelerated the shift toward steam and chemical sterilization methods for reusable nylon cuffs, positioning them as both cost-effective and environmentally conscious alternatives to disposable variants.

Furthermore, escalating emphasis on value-based care has reshaped procurement criteria, prioritizing devices that deliver quantifiable efficiency gains. Value creation now extends beyond unit costs to encompass total cost of ownership, ease of integration into electronic medical records, and predictive maintenance capabilities. Consequently, industry participants are realigning R&D investments and commercial strategies to address these converging trends, reinforcing the imperative for stakeholders to anticipate and adapt to an increasingly complex market landscape.

Examining the Ripple Effects of New Tariff Policies on the United States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uffs Market Throughout 2025

The imposition of updated tariff regulations in early 2025 has introduced significant headwinds for the nylon pressure infusion cuff market in the United States. With import duties applied to select polymer and textile inputs, manufacturers have confronted higher landed costs, leading to a recalibration of pricing models and contract negotiations. Supply chain volatility has intensified as firms evaluate alternative sourcing destinations in Asia and Latin America to offset increased import expenses.

These tariffs have also spurred domestic manufacturers to revisit production footprints, considering onshore assembly lines or co-manufacturing partnerships with fabricators in tariff-exempt zones. Such strategic shifts carry implications for lead times, quality assurance protocols, and capital expenditure plans. As suppliers navigate this evolving trade environment, clinical buyers are scrutinizing long-term service agreements and framework contracts to secure stable pricing and inventory availability.

Transitioning from short-term mitigation tactics to sustainable supply resilience demands coordinated efforts across procurement, regulatory, and operations teams. Organizations that proactively assess total landed costs, optimize inventory buffers, and engage in forward-looking trade compliance strategies will be best positioned to maintain continuity of care and cost efficiency amidst ongoing policy fluctuations.

Uncovering Critical Insights from Diverse Segmentation Dimensions Informing Tailored Strategies in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uff Applications

Insights derived from multiple segmentation lenses reveal the nuanced ways in which end users, product variations, and purchasing channels intersect to shape market dynamics. In environments ranging from high-volume hospitals to homecare settings, the choice between automatic, manual, and semi-automatic pressure infusion cuffs is dictated by clinical workflows and staffing capabilities. While large hospitals often adopt fully automatic systems for rapid throughput, ambulatory surgical centers and outpatient clinics may rely on semi-automatic or manual devices for their blend of affordability and operational simplicity.

Moreover, application contexts such as blood transfusion, pressure infusion, and volume infusion each demand specific compliance profiles and performance thresholds. Devices deployed in critical care wards prioritize high-pressure ranges and digital monitoring interfaces, whereas low-pressure, adjustable-range units are favored in homecare scenarios to accommodate variable patient mobility. Purchasing pathways further influence adoption patterns: direct tenders with group purchasing organizations can secure volume discounts, distribution channels enable regional reach and aftermarket support, and online procurement platforms cater to smaller orders and urgent replacements.

Reusability considerations also play a pivotal role. Single-use cuffs offer convenience and infection control, but reusable options sterilized via steam or chemical processes present a compelling value proposition for high-frequency applications. As end users weigh total operating costs against safety protocols, understanding these segmentation dynamics is critical for manufacturers and buyers seeking to tailor product portfolios to evolving clinical and commercial imperatives.

Highlighting the Strategic Regional Perspectives across Americas EMEA and Asia-Pacific Influencing Nylon Pressure Infusion Cuff Market Penetration

Geographic nuances significantly mold the competitive and regulatory fabric of the nylon pressure infusion cuff market. In the Americas, the United States and Canada lead in the uptake of advanced pressure monitoring systems, fueled by stringent patient safety mandates and well-established healthcare infrastructures. Latin American nations are gradually expanding their hospital networks, creating emerging pockets of demand for cost-effective manual and semi-automatic cuff solutions.

Conversely, the Europe, Middle East & Africa region exhibits pronounced heterogeneity. Western European healthcare systems prioritize interoperable devices compatible with existing digital platforms, driving demand for smart, automatic cuffs. Meanwhile, in parts of the Middle East, infrastructure investments and healthcare modernization programs are catalyzing interest in both reusable and disposable variants. In Africa, penetration remains modest, yet evolving telemedicine initiatives present opportunities for portable infusion devices in remote clinics.

Across Asia-Pacific, rapid hospital expansions in China, India, and Southeast Asia are expanding the market for entry-level manual cuffs, while tier-1 cities increasingly embrace high-pressure and adjustable-range units with advanced safety features. National regulatory bodies in these markets are accelerating approval processes to meet growing domestic demand, further incentivizing multinational firms and local manufacturers to collaborate on tailored solutions.

Such regional insights underscore the importance of aligning product development, regulatory strategy, and go-to-market approaches with distinct geographic drivers, ensuring optimized resource allocation and market penetration across divergent healthcare ecosystems.
